Remove "recheck" argument from check_index_is_clusterable()
The last usage of this argument in this routine can be tracked down to 7e2f9062, aka 11 years ago. Getting rid of this argument can also be an advantage for extensions calling check_index_is_clusterable(), as it removes any need to worry about the meaning of what a recheck would be at this level.
